Output c26a337e17b12da21560efa7eb69e4fc9a78a0da55f3234b772de23648852597:18

value
1080
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f7c5908ca75ce7c10049191825f9349688f8d20e64ecc1417a9d5967553f20f8
address
bc1p7lzepr98tnnuzqzfryvzt7f5j6y035swvnkvzst6n4vkw4flyruqtpmglm
transaction
c26a337e17b12da21560efa7eb69e4fc9a78a0da55f3234b772de23648852597
confirmations
72642
spent
true